Runbook: Widegap diff viewer — large file handling. If diffs over 200 MB stall, check the chunker workers first; restart only after draining the render queue. Memory caps are deliberate — do not raise them without checking node headroom. Logs live under the standard viewer path. Future maintainers: resist the urge to disable streaming mode. The service ships with these configuration values.

deployment values, yadug-bawif:
[framir]
team = pelox
access_code = ac_a38ab2
owner = tamion.julael
host = framir.tolvaqlabs.test
port = 11211
peer = tammir.zemvargrid.local
salt = 2215ef03
pin = 1541

The Fernlock vault that stores the signing secret for the Cartwheel parcel-tracking webhook sealed itself after three failed unseal attempts during last night's deploy. Until it is reopened, Cartwheel cannot verify inbound delivery events from the Marrowfield depot feed, and retries are piling up in the dead-letter queue. Please unseal carefully: confirm the cluster is quorate, then run the standard unseal flow from the bastion. The recovery passphrase you will need is below.

strongbox words: norwyn-wenael-aldvan-aldiel-wendor-holael

Management Meeting Minutes — Reseller Programme

Present: Dena Forsgate, Ollie Rennick, Priya Calloway.

Quick recap: the Fernlight reseller programme is tracking ahead of plan — 14 partners signed versus the 10 we'd hoped for. Margins are a bit thinner than modelled, mostly down to the tiered discount we offered early joiners. Ollie will tighten the discount bands before the next intake. Where we want to take the programme next is covered in the note below.

board note of yahip-tadug: Headcount on the Zorath team goes from 9 to 100 by the end of April. Gross margin on Zorath came in at 10 percent against a plan of 20 percent.

**☐ Basement Archive Room — Night Shift**

New starters: the Dunmere archive room is in Basement Level 1, past the freight lift. Lights are on a ten-minute timer. Sign the access log on the shelf inside the door. Refile boxes exactly where found; the retrieval log matters for audits. Lock up when leaving. The door keypad takes the code below.

staff pass of kagef-yahip = bdg-TKELFT-63915354